How to fill out the IRS Instructions 1099-K online
Filling out the IRS Instructions 1099-K form can seem daunting, especially for first-time users. This guide provides a clear and structured approach to help you complete the form accurately and efficiently online.
Follow the steps to fill out the IRS Instructions 1099-K form online.
- Press the ‘Get Form’ button to acquire the form and open it in your online editor.
- Enter your name, address, and phone number in the upper left corner of the form. Include all necessary details to ensure clarity.
- Check the appropriate box for your role: whether you are a Payment Settlement Entity (PSE) or a third party.
- In Box 1a, report the gross amount of total reportable payment transactions for the calendar year, not accounting for adjustments.
- Fill in Box 1b with the gross amount where the card was not present during the transaction, such as online sales.
- Complete the Merchant Category Code in Box 2 by entering the 4-digit code that describes the nature of the business.
- In Box 3, input the total number of payment transactions processed during the year.
- If applicable, report any federal income tax withheld in Box 4 due to backup withholding rules.
- Fill in the monthly amounts for Boxes 5a through 5l as required.
- Review all entered information for accuracy and completeness before proceeding.
